Scalability Measurement of a Proxy based Personalized Multimedia Repurposing System

Multimedia content repurposing is a new challenge in distributing multimedia systems due to the heterogeneity of client devices and their network connections. This paper addresses the problem of heterogeneity and proposes a solution that uses a series of repurposing proxies in a chain fashion. In order to find the best scalable repurposing service among those proxies, two modified versions of the shortest path selection algorithms have been implemented. The scalability of the services has been measured in terms of user satisfaction. An implemented Java-based prototype as well as computer simulation results shows the viability of our approach
